## Artifact Signing: Datelocale Module

The Datelocale module handles localized date formatting across all Fernhaven products, so a tampered build could silently corrupt rendered dates in every locale. For that reason, releases are signed at build time and verified again at deploy. Maintainers must never bypass verification, even for hotfixes; rebuild and re-sign instead. Verification is performed against the module's published key, which is recorded immediately below for reference.

deploy key for kajof-fajop: bky6_gDHw9Q

Vendor note: Brightmoor Systems delivers webhooks with at-most-once semantics by default. We contractually require at-least-once with exponential backoff, retried for 24 hours, and idempotency keys on every payload. Verify these settings during each contract renewal, and record any deviation in the vendor register. For clarification on the agreed retry schedule, write to the vendor liaison.

billing contact of kajeg-tahof = soriel.istwyn.aldeth@ferragrid.corp

Subject: DR drill — fuel report pipeline

Team,

Quick notes for the weekly sync. Thursday we run the disaster-recovery drill on the Cartwheel fleet fuel-usage report. Scope: kill the primary aggregator in the Dunmoor region, confirm the standby picks up and the weekly fuel report still lands on schedule. Owners: Priya on failover, Tomas on validation. One blocker — restoring the archived baseline dataset requires unlocking the cold-storage bundle, so keep the recovery passphrase below handy.

vault phrase of tajop-haduf = holath-brivan-wenax